Who is Dr. Klenoff, Otolaryngologist in Stamford, CT?
Dr. Jason Klenoff, MD is an Otolaryngologist, who primarily practices in Stamford, CT. He has been practicing for over 21 years and is board certified. Dr. Klenoff graduated from Yale University School of Medicine and completed his residency at Yale New Haven Hosp, General Surgery.

What is Dr. Jason Klenoff's specialty?
Dr. Klenoff is a Otolaryngologist near Stamford, CT.
An otolaryngologist-head and neck surgeon provides comprehensive medical and surgical care for conditions affecting the ears, nose, throat, respiratory, and upper alimentary systems, as well as related head and neck structures. This specialist diagnoses and treats diseases, allergies, neoplasms, deformities, disorders, and injuries involving these areas. Is this Dr. Jason Klenoff aff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?
Yes, Dr. Klenoff is affiliated with Stamford Hospital which is a Castle Connolly
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their
exc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through
a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the
top 25% nationwide.
